98' Lincoln Mark VIII LSC 92,000 4.6L 290hp

First off you should know the air ride is long since gone. Replaced it with a coilspring, shock, and spring setup... fixed all susp problem. Now I have a brake problem. Brakes rotors and pads are new premium napa parts. Tires and allignment is new as off monday.(ALL Installed chasing this problem) At speeds of 45 and above when you tap the brakes it jerks the car to the right. Then when ya let off it goes back to the left. Other than that brakes are fine no shudder car stops really well good pedal. My cousin is a certified import mechanic. In 14 yrs this is the first thing to stump him as far as my cars go. He checked all the brake, susp, steering, and bracing componets. All aprear to be working normally. He double checked the calipers thinking they were it they are fine. Alignment was fine. He Installed new rubber hoses today cause it was the only thing that had any sign of a problem..... one hose swelled up more than the other. New hoses still doing it... Any ideas before I
take it to (Gulp) Lincoln ?
